Set against the backdrop of war and romance, A Moment of Romance III (1996) tells the poignant story of a fighter pilot's unexpected sojourn in a remote farming community. Here, he finds solace and love in the unlikeliest of places.

Director: Johnnie To

What is A Moment of Romance III (1996) about?

This poignant film tells the story of a fighter pilot who finds love in a remote farming community after being forced to ditch in a field.

Who directed A Moment of Romance III?

The film was directed by the renowned Johnnie To, known for his masterful direction in the action and romance genres.

Who stars in A Moment of Romance III?

The main cast includes Andy Lau, Jacklyn Wu Chien-Lien, Fan Chi-Gong, Alex Fong Chung-Sun, and Zhang Yan.
